1. A method of preparing a positive electrode active material for rechargeable lithium ion batteries, the method comprising:
primary heat-treating a precursor material and a lithium material to obtain a lithium metal oxide;
dissolving a sulfur material in water to prepare a washing solution;
immersing the lithium metal oxide in the washing solution to wash the lithium metal oxide; and
secondary heat-treating the washed lithium metal oxide,
wherein the positive electrode active material comprises:
a lithium metal oxide active material;
a coating layer on a surface of the lithium metal oxide active material,
wherein the coating layer comprises a sulfur compound,
wherein the rechargeable lithium ion batteries contains a liquid electrolytes,
wherein the sulfur compound is included in the coating layer in an amount ranging from 0.5 wt % to 5.0 wt % with respect to a total weight of the positive electrode active material,
wherein the sulfur compound in the coating layer comprises one or more selected from the group consisting of Li2S, Li2SO4, and Li2SnOx, wherein n is 1≤n≤8, and
wherein the sulfur material is a compound of M2SxOy wherein x ranges from 1 to 8, y ranges from 1 to 8, M is Na or K, and z ranges from 0 to 3.
